Normal weather for the Amalfi Coast in January

It's cool in January in the Amalfi Coast with an average temperature of 13°C. Temperatures this month range from a low of 12°C to a high of 14°C. At night, you can expect temperatures between 4°C and 8°C.

In January, there is an average of 76 mm of precipitation, spread over 11 days. Of the total precipitation, about 0,1 cm falls as snow in January. The wind speed is around 3 Bft, mostly coming from the South.

The UV index is a maximum of 4 this month. That's a moderate value on the intensity scale of 1 to 11. Unprotected skin can burn in about 30 minutes.

Start of January

The month of January starts in Amalfi Coast with cool temperatures, averaging around 13°C during the day and nights close to 8°C. A few showers might pop up in the first days of the month, but the weather remains mostly sunny and dry.

Mid-January

By mid-January, the average daytime temperature stays the same at 13°C, with nights close to 7°C. During this part of the month, you can expect regular precipitation, but there’ll also be some sunny days.

End of January

By the end of January, the average daytime temperature in Amalfi Coast will be around 13°C, with nights close to 7°C. A shower might show up, but overall the weather will be dry and sunny.

Temperature records

With 20°C, the Amalfi Coast hit the highest temperature in the last 10 years in January 2018. The lowest daytime temperature in this month was 1°C in 2017. The extreme night temperatures ranged from a low of -2°C to a high of 14°C.
